Blackfish Offers Two Decadent Dining Experiences

To celebrate 12/12/12, a five-course lunch does the trick. If you’re worried about the world ending before Christmas, devour all the luscious treats you can at the restaurant’s “End of the World” dinner.

Thank goodness we get a special date like Dec. 12, 2012 this year, if for no other reason than to celebrate with a fantastic 12/12/12 lunch at 12:12 p.m. On that Wednesday, Chip Roman is hosting a “Best of Blackfish” lunch with some of Roman’s signature dinner dishes from the past six years—that’s some good eatin! For $95  (includes tax and gratuity), diners will be treated to a luscious five-course meal, with items like a liquid-center foie gras terrine, Blackfish surf and turf with braised short ribs and diver scallops, and cheeses and dessert, to name only a few. There will only be one seating that day, so guests are asked to call and reserve one of only 50 spots, and arrive promptly at 11:45 a.m.

If you can’t make it out for lunch on Dec. 12, there’s always the “End of the World” dinner on Dec. 20, which is designed around the Mayan calendar, which ends on the Dec. 21. Many have prophesized that’s when the world will end, but we see it as another excuse to treat ourselves to a fantastic meal. The eight-course meal will feature some of the most expensive food items from around the world, like royal ossetra caviar, foie gras and black truffles, lobster, Kobe beef and much more. There will be seatings from 6-10 p.m. and 60 guests will be accommodated at each one (the meal should take about three hours). The cost is $169 per person, which includes tax and gratuity, and a reservation is also required. Don’t forget to bring plenty of wine, as Blackfish is a BYOB.
